Output 8e29c110b53a6366effc81bdc75b241658492fe11f8af8490143c77b89793651:0

value
24683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dfefd81180b30d0f942b3ac8a8932f76be10bfc OP_EQUAL
address
35tDoD6Zj4jFj9PwAE1JpS6K4aRrJnMsxo
transaction
8e29c110b53a6366effc81bdc75b241658492fe11f8af8490143c77b89793651
spent
true